Most Zimbabwean banking institutions have surpassed the minimum regulatory capital requirements, reflecting stability, resilience, and soundness in the country’s financial system, according to the latest data from the Reserve Bank of Zimbabwe (RBZ). The 2025 Mid-Term Monetary Policy Review Statement, presented by RBZ Governor Dr John Mushayavanhu on Thursday, reveals that 17 of the 19 …
